What does a standard electrical inspection involve for my Reading home?
Our comprehensive electrical inspection involves a systematic review of your home's wiring, service panel, outlets, switches, and grounding systems. We specifically check for common local issues like overheating outlets and GFCI failures in kitchens and bathrooms. The goal is to identify potential safety hazards, ensure your system meets current National Electrical Code standards, and provide you with a clear, prioritized report on any recommended repairs or updates to keep your home safe and functional.
I have an older home in Reading with outlets that feel warm. Is this an emergency?
An overheating outlet is a serious safety concern that should be addressed promptly. For Reading residents, this is often a sign of loose wiring connections, an overloaded circuit, or outdated components that can't handle modern electrical demands. We recommend shutting off power to that circuit and calling for service. Our 24-hour emergency team can diagnose the cause, which is often related to the age of the home's wiring or specific high-use appliances, and make the necessary repairs to prevent a potential fire hazard.
